How does economics impact on politicians? And how do politicians impact on economics?You will study both contemporary economics and the political leaders who have put key economic theories into practice throughout history.
Learn from experts in the field
The course is led by Sir Vince Cable, Leader of the Liberal Democrats and Honorary Professor of Economics at the University of Nottingham.
You will also learn from leading economists at the University of Nottingham, including Head of School Professor Kevin Lee and Professor of Political Economy Cecilia Testa. The Politics of Economics and the Economics of Politicians is offered at The University of Nottingham by FutureLearn .
